Kathleen K. Seefeldt Award for Arts Excellence
The Kathleen K. Seefeldt Awards for Arts excellence were established over 15 years ago by the Prince William Arts Council to recognize and celebrate the artists, arts organizations, volunteers, educators and business that build upon and sustain Ms. Seefeldt’s legacy of public service and support for the cultural arts.
Persons 18 years of age or older and organizations from Prince William County, Manassas and Manassas Park who live, work or volunteer in these locales may be nominated for the Seefeldt Award. Nominations should be made based on their significant or distinguished contribution to arts in the region. Previous winners cannot win in the same category for five years. Self-nominations are also accepted. Judges for the awards will include previous award winners as well as artists and community supporters of the arts.

SEEFELDT AWARDS 2019 Winners
The Prince William County Arts Council hosted the 2019 Kathleen K. Seefeldt Awards at the Hylton Performing Arts Center.
Photographer: Mike Beaty & Keith Walker
THE ANNUAL KATHLEEN K. SEEFELDT AWARDS FOR ARTS EXCELLENCE Winners:
Outstanding Volunteer – John Dutton
Outstanding Individual Artist – Rafik Hegab
Outstanding Arts Organization – Manassas Symphony Orchestra
Outstanding Educator – Lawanda Council
Outstanding Patron – Kathleen Gurchiek
Outstanding Business Supporter of the Arts – Compton & Duling
Pioneer Award for Lifetime Contributions to the Arts – James Gallagher
